Panaderia y Pasterleria Totopan is conveniently located at 7117 20th Ave, Brooklyn, NY 11204, USA. This address places it in a vibrant, community-focused section of Brooklyn that is easily accessible for a wide range of local residents. For those who travel via public transportation, the cafe is situated within a reasonable walking distance of the D train at the 71st Street station. This makes it a quick and convenient stop for commuters and neighborhood regulars alike. Additionally, a number of bus lines operate in the vicinity, providing even more options for getting to the bakery without a car. For residents living in the surrounding areas of Bensonhurst and Borough Park, the cafe is a perfect spot for a morning or afternoon walk. Its location on 20th Avenue, a commercial street with a mix of businesses, makes it a natural part of a day's errands or a planned outing. While street parking can sometimes be challenging in this dense Brooklyn neighborhood, the excellent public transit options ensure that the bakery is a practical and easy-to-reach destination for everyone.
